Transaction 56f4e20ab8511a124cf58fbef01c30190049690505e9cc029f19d23ecbe51c2f

2 Input
2 Outputs
  • 56f4e20ab8511a124cf58fbef01c30190049690505e9cc029f19d23ecbe51c2f:0
  • value  1433800
    address  3CsbSbUAdVJpTXkZY9K8cN1KEDiMxsrSpu
  • 56f4e20ab8511a124cf58fbef01c30190049690505e9cc029f19d23ecbe51c2f:1
  • value  186870
    address  34E9Za5kLNeLtDyvfZ3iQ684PDX7SFaAsK